I therefore issued the necessary orders to carry it into effect, and determined to suspend operations till I received orders to renew them, or till circumstances apparent to me should seem to justify independent action. General Cobb gave me every assistance in his power in the collection of supplies for my command. He directed his quartermasters and commissaries throughout the State, particularly in South-Western Georgia, to ship their grain and provisions to me, and this before any terms of capitulation had been made known to him or myself.
